Good cleanser, moisturizer, and sunscreen. Honestly finding the right cleanser has done more for me than any of the toners/serums I’ve used, I have really dry skin so after switching to something more gentle it healed right up.

I also use vitamin C serum for acne scars/uneven coloration, it’s pretty strong stuff so not every day. That and a lot of acids can make your skin more vulnerable to sunburns

A good base would be twice daily: Step 1. Mild cleanser Step 2. Moisturizer Step 3. (For daytime only) sunscreen. People add in extra cleansing/ serum/ exfoliating steps to that basic routine to try to achieve various results but it's not always necessary.
